A comprehensive public pension reform was implemented in 1999 and the Swedish
pension system is nowadays based on (7) retirement age and a flexible (8)pension system There
are three components in the Swedish public (9) pension system: income pension, based on a
person’s full lifetime earnings and financed on a pay-as-you-go basis; premium pension, which is
a smaller and funded part of the income-based pension; and guarantee pension which provides a
basic income for all persons, irrespective of their previous lifetime earnings. The statutory
pension system is complemented by collectively bargained occupational pension schemes, which
cover about 90% of the workforce. The pension system provides the freedom to combine work
with retirement, and both employees and self-employed persons are entitled to (10)……
postponing retirement…………... Statutory income pension is payable from (11) the age of 61
for both men and women. However, the size of the pension will increase the longer the
retirement is postponed, and the financial incentives for (12)…lifetime earnings.. are strong.
Nevertheless, the standard age of retirement in Sweden is 65 years for both men and women.
